How much does a fractional VP of Sales cost in Jacksonville in 2027?
Quick Answer
A fractional VP of Sales in Jacksonville in 2027 will likely cost you between $8,000 and $18,000 per month for a standard 10-15 day engagement. The final number depends on your company stage, the scope of work, and whether you need a generalist or a specialist with deep experience in Jacksonville's dominant industries.

Direct Answer

If you are a founder or CEO in Jacksonville evaluating fractional revenue leadership, expect to pay a monthly retainer of roughly $8,000 to $18,000 for a part-time VP of Sales. This range covers 10 to 15 days of work per month, including pipeline reviews, deal coaching, sales process design, and executive meetings. For a very early-stage startup needing only 5-7 days per month, you might find rates as low as $5,000, while a complex B2B company with multiple sales teams could exceed $20,000. Most fractional leaders in this market work on a flat monthly fee, not hourly, and they rarely include equity unless you are pre-seed and offering significant upside. Be honest with yourself about what you need: a "fractional VP of Sales" who just attends meetings is cheaper than one who builds your entire sales infrastructure.

How to hire a fractional VP of Sales in Jacksonville
1
Define your engagement scope
List the specific outcomes you need (e.g., hire first reps, build a sales playbook, close enterprise deals)
2
Assess your stage and budget
Pre-seed companies often pay less but offer equity; Series A+ pays higher cash retainers
3
Search local and remote
Jacksonville has a thin pool of experienced fractional CROs; many strong candidates work remote from Atlanta, Tampa, or Miami
4
Interview for industry fit
Ask about experience in logistics, fintech, or healthcare — Jacksonville's core sectors
5
Negotiate a 90-day trial
Most fractional leaders will agree to a 3-month contract with a 30-day out clause
6
Set clear KPIs and reporting cadence
Weekly pipeline reviews and monthly board-level updates are standard

Why Jacksonville matters for fractional sales leadership

Jacksonville is not a small market — it's the largest city by land area in the continental U.S. and home to a dense concentration of logistics, fintech, and healthcare companies. The presence of major employers like CSX, Fidelity, and Baptist Health means there is a local talent pool of experienced sales leaders, but most of them are in full-time roles. The fractional market here is thinner than in Atlanta or Miami, so you may need to look regionally or accept a remote arrangement. The cost of living in Jacksonville is roughly 10-15% lower than the national average, which slightly depresses fractional rates compared to San Francisco or New York, but strong demand from growing companies keeps prices competitive.

Fractional vs. full-time: the real trade-off

The table above gives you the numbers, but here is the honest strategic analysis. A full-time VP of Sales in Jacksonville costs $25,000-$40,000 per month in base salary alone, plus benefits, bonus, and equity. For a company under $5M ARR, that is often 30-50% of your total revenue. A fractional leader at $12,000/month gives you seasoned expertise without the fixed overhead. The downside is availability: a fractional leader will not be in your office every day, and they will not answer Slack at 10 PM. If your business needs constant, hands-on management of a growing team, a full-time hire is better. If you need strategy, process, and coaching, fractional is often superior.

⚠️ Watch out
Warning: Do not hire a fractional VP of Sales expecting them to be a full-time employee who works evenings and weekends. They are not. If your company needs constant, hands-on management, you are better off hiring a full-time VP of Sales or a senior sales director. Fractional works best when you have a clear, limited scope and a team that can execute with strategic guidance.

How to structure the engagement for success

The most successful fractional VP of Sales engagements I have seen follow this pattern:

  1. Kickoff week: Intensive on-site or virtual sessions to map your sales process, review your CRM, and meet your team.
  2. Weekly rhythm: A 90-minute pipeline review, a 60-minute coaching session per rep, and a 30-minute executive sync.
  3. Monthly board report: A one-page summary of pipeline health, forecast accuracy, and key metrics.
  4. Quarterly deep dive: A full-day strategy session to adjust territories, compensation, and hiring plans.
  5. Exit plan: A documented playbook for the next leader, whether that is a full-time hire or a new fractional partner.

FAQ

What is the typical hourly rate for a fractional VP of Sales in Jacksonville? Most fractional leaders do not charge by the hour. They use a monthly retainer based on days committed. If you push for an hourly rate, expect $150-$300 per hour, but you will pay more for the same work because they will track every minute. A flat monthly fee is almost always better for both parties.

Can I get a fractional VP of Sales for under $5,000 per month? Yes, but only for a very limited scope — for example, 5 days per month of pure strategy and no team management. At that price, you are buying advice, not execution. If you need someone to build processes, coach reps, and close deals, expect to pay $8,000 or more.

Do fractional VP of Sales in Jacksonville offer equity? Rarely for cash engagements. If you are pre-seed and cannot afford market rates, some will take a small equity stake (0.5-2%) in exchange for a reduced cash retainer. This is a negotiation, not a standard offer.

What if I need someone for only 3 months? Many fractional leaders will take a 3-month engagement, but expect a premium for short-term work (10-20% higher monthly rate). A 6-month engagement is the sweet spot for cost and impact.

Is a fractional VP of Sales the same as a fractional CRO? No. A fractional CRO oversees the entire revenue organization (sales, marketing, customer success) and costs $15,000-$25,000 per month. A fractional VP of Sales focuses on the sales team and pipeline. If you have no marketing or CS function, start with a VP of Sales.

Should I hire a local Jacksonville leader or a remote one? If your team is in-office, a local leader is better for culture and coaching. If you are remote-first, location does not matter. Jacksonville has a thin local pool, so be open to remote candidates from Atlanta, Tampa, or Miami.
